Описание слайда:
Процедура проверки выпуклости или вогнутости некоторой функции является более простой, чем доказательство выпуклости множества допустимых решений экстремальной задачи. Так как выпуклость допустимого множества может быть установлена путем непосредственной проверки выпуклости или вогнутости функций ограничений, по этой причине мы приводим перечень требований, которые легче использовать на практике. Чтобы установить эти требования, рассмотрим задачу нелинейного программирования в общей постановке. Процедура проверки выпуклости или вогнутости некоторой функции является более простой, чем доказательство выпуклости множества допустимых решений экстремальной задачи. Так как выпуклость допустимого множества может быть установлена путем непосредственной проверки выпуклости или вогнутости функций ограничений, по этой причине мы приводим перечень требований, которые легче использовать на практике. Чтобы установить эти требования, рассмотрим задачу нелинейного программирования в общей постановке. Максимизировать и минимизировать z = f(x) при ограничениях gi(x) ≤ 0, i = 1, 2, …, r, gi(x) ≥ 0, i = r + 1, 2, …, p, gi(x) = 0, i = p + 1, 2, …, m. При этом функция Лагранжа имеет вид где i — множитель Лагранжа, соответствующий i-му ограничению. Требования, которые устанавливают достаточность условий Куна – Таккера, приведены в табл. 8.2. В табл. 8.2 представлена лишь часть условий, упомянутых в табл. 8.1. Это связано с тем, что область допустимых решений задачи может быть выпуклой и в то же время функции ограничений, которые ее формируют, не соответствуют требованиям, перечисленным в табл. 8.2. Таблица 8.2 Законность положений табл. 8.2 основана на том, что при сформулированных условиях функция Лагранжа L(X, S, ) является вогнутой в случае задачи максимизации и выпуклой — в случае задачи минимизации. Это подтверждается тем, что если gi(X) — выпуклая функция, то функция I gi(X) оказывается выпуклой при i ≥ 0 и вогнутой — при i ≤ 0. Аналогичные рассуждения подтверждают все остальные условия. Заметим также, что линейная функция является как выпуклой, так и вогнутой. Наконец, если функция f вогнутая, то функция –f является выпуклой, и наоборот.